Ministry of Legal Affairs & Human Rights celebrates Int'l Human Rights Day
[12/12/2021 03:45]
Aden - Saba
The Ministry of Legal Affairs and Human Rights and the United Nations High Commissioner for Human Rights organized in the temporary capital Aden today a workshop on the human rights and humanitarian situation in Yemen as part of the celebration of the 73rd anniversary of International Human Rights Day, which falls on the tenth of December of each year.
The workshop reviewed two working papers, the first of which was prepared by the head of the Chamber of Commerce, Abu Bakr Ba’beed, in which he indicated that the security situation in our country left an impact on trade in general, which by extension aggravated the humanitarian situation, especially with the high exchange rates of foreign currency, while the second was about the work of the Independent National Commission for Investigation In Human Rights Violations as presented by Dr. Muhammad Al-Talyan.
The paper reviewed the activities of the National Committee aimed at monitoring all violations and punishing the perpetrators.
At the ceremony, many speeches were given by civil society organizations.
